SA vs IND 2018: Virat Kohli 'Very Excited' About Second Test

Team India might have lost the first Test against South Africa, but the mood in the Indian camp is far from being gloomy. On the very next day after the crushing defeat in New Zealand, India’s benched quartet – Ishant Sharma, Parthiv Patel, Ajinkya Rahane and KL Rahul – were seen sweating it out in the nets and now captain Virat Kohli’s latest tweet more or less proves that the mood in the Indian camp is upbeat despite the loss.
India arrived in the African country on the back of nine consecutive series wins but failed to come up with an all-round performance against the Proteas. Virat Kohli & Co. started the proceedings in Cape Town on a stunning note with Bhuvneshwar Kumar ripping through South Africa’s top-order to reduce them to 12 for three. However, they let South Africa off the hook from thereon, as the Proteas recovered from the disastrous start and posted 286.
In reply, India’s top-order failed to put up a good show on a tough pitch. The visitors were reeling at 92 for seven before Hardik Pandya’s 93-run knock helped them post 209.

India’s bowlers then gave their side a big chance of winning the game by dismissing South Africa for just 130. But the batsmen once again failed to compliment the bowlers as India were all out for a mere 135.
Kohli, who had scored one century and a couple of double centuries in his last Test series, failed to lead his team from the front, scoring just 5 and 28 in two innings. However, the skipper seems to have moved on after the rare failure and is now excited for the second Test which gets underway on Saturday (January 13).
The 29-year old took to Twitter to post a selfie alongside Hardik Pandya with the caption:
“Touchdown Joburg, what a City!?? Gearing up for the next one and very excited about it.”
